Delong / Kaymar

Advertisement

27 Delong Dr
Ottawa, ON K1J 7E5

At the bus stop located at 27 Delong Dr in Ottawa, ON, CA, passengers can catch their ride conveniently at the intersection of Delong and Kaymar.

Generated from this place's information

Own this business?
See a problem?

You might also like

CanadaOntarioOttawaDelong / Kaymar

Advertisement